The Implementation of Reactive Systems

Implementing such reactive systems requires a sophisticated underlying framework. It’s not simply about adding branching narratives; it's about designing game mechanics that respond dynamically to a wide range of player inputs. This involves advanced algorithms capable of analyzing player behaviour, predicting likely actions, and adapting the game world accordingly. For example, a player who consistently demonstrates a preference for stealth tactics might find that the game world subtly shifts to favour opportunities for covert movement, while a more aggressive player may encounter more frequent and challenging combat encounters. This adaptive approach ensures that each playthrough feels unique and tailored to the individual player's style.

Balancing Freedom and Structure

One of the biggest challenges in designing for vincispin is finding the right balance between freedom and structure. Too much freedom can lead to a chaotic and disjointed experience, while too much structure can stifle creativity and limit player agency. The key is to create a framework that provides players with clear goals and objectives, but also allows them the flexibility to approach those goals in their own way. This could involve providing multiple avenues for completing a quest, allowing players to choose their own allies, or giving them the power to influence the game’s political landscape. Essentially, the role of the game designer shifts from being a storyteller to being a facilitator of player-driven narratives.
